Knowledge of the Law<br /><br />You have the right to file a lawsuit against an at-fault person for any losses you suffered in the event of a car crash. You may se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ages and property damage. The amount you receive will depend on the law in your state and if you were responsible for the crash.<br /><br />An attorney's knowledge of law can be invaluable in your case. They will know what laws apply to you, and assist with the documents. This can help you save time and frustration, and ensure that your claim is filed on time.<br /><br />Legal knowledge from a lawyer can also assist you in gathering evidence to back up your claim. This may include photos of the crash scene as well as police reports and witness statements. Your lawyer can help you connect with medical professionals and other people who can provide information regarding your injuries.<br /><br />You can also seek out advice on the amount of pain and suffering damages available to cover your losses. This is especially important for victims of severe injury who have difficulty managing the pain.<br /><br />It is essential to contact an attorney as soon following a serious accident as you can. A delay in seeking legal advice could mean you miss out on crucial evidence that is vital to your case.<br /><br />A lawyer for car accidents who has experience will know the different deadlines for legal filings to meet to file a claim for compensation. Each state has its own statutes of limitations which govern personal injury claims. You might not be eligible to receive compensation if you submit your claim late.<br /><br />It is recommended to find an auto accidents attorney near me who specializes in personal injuries and car crashes.
